
Faisal Abu Al-Sindian, a student from the Faculty of Media at Middle East University, participated in the “Middle East, Caspian, and North Caucasus International Forum,” which was hosted by the North Caucasus Federal University (СККФУ) in Sevastopol, Russia.
The event attracted over 100 students representing 15 countries, including Jordan, Armenia, Turkey, Tunisia, Algeria, Egypt, Azerbaijan, and Tunisia, along with foreign students from prominent universities in southern Russia.
Middle East University’s participation underscores its dedication to offering its students advanced educational opportunities and cultural experiences as part of its constructive partnership with the Russian House in Amman.
The objective of the forum was to establish a platform that would facilitate the exchange of ideas and experiences among young leaders from diverse cultural backgrounds, with the ultimate goal of fostering sustainable collaborative partnerships. The forum featured a range of activities, including intensive training courses, interactive intellectual activities, and specialised classes in media and media production.
